At Hemel Hempstead station, the convenience starts even before you board your train. The ticket office is open from early morning until night, with hours from 06:00 to 20:00 on weekdays and a little later on weekends. Those rushing against time can opt to collect their online tickets from the easily accessible machines available. If you require assistance, knowledgeable staff is on-hand at various help points during these hours to ensure a smooth travel experience.
For modern-day travelers, step-free access and various accessible amenities, such as accessible toilets and induction loops, ensure everyone's needs are met. Although the station lacks waiting rooms, comfort is prioritized with ample seating areas. The station also boasts essential amenities such as ATM machines, refreshment facilities, and shops to grab a quick snack or essentials for your journey.
Smooth onward travel is central to the station's design. Rail replacement services can be conveniently accessed from the bus stops outside the station. Various local bus services facilitate your onward journey within the town or to surrounding areas, enhancing the overall connectivity you experience here.
Taxis can be arranged using the taxi free phones available, making travel into the heart of Hemel Hempstead or onward to destinations in the area straightforward and trouble-free.

Eridge station is equipped with essential amenities designed to make your visit smooth and hassle-free. You’ll find a ticket office open Monday through Saturday, with automated ticket machines available if you arrive outside these hours. The station provides step-free access making it easily navigable for all passengers. Although there are no waiting rooms, the station does have seating areas and basic facilities such as toilets on platform one. It's worth noting that there are no refreshment options on-site, so you might want to grab a snack beforehand.
The station boasts accessible ticket machines capable of providing disc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ders and has help points available on platforms to offer assistance when needed. While a tranquil spot, the absence of a waiting room and retail facilities might mean planning ahead is wise.
Your travel from Eridge doesn’t have to end when you leave the train. The station is well-connected with local bus services, and there are occasional rail replacement services operating. While you won't find cycle hire facilities here, bicycle stands are available should you decide to explore the area on two wheels.
Getting to and from the station is straightforward, although options like accessible taxis aren't readily available from the station. Ensure you've planned your onward journey by checking the latest information and schedules.
